Heart Sound Recorder - A non-invasive diagnostic tool that analyzes the acoustic patterns of cardiac function. It helps detect subtle turbulence, valve irregularities, and hemodynamic stress that may not be apparent on routine examination. Capturing and digitally analyzing heart sounds provides additional insight into cardiovascular performance and early functional changes. When integrated with imaging and laboratory data, it strengthens our ability to assess risk and guide targeted cardiovascular support. read more

Max Pulse - Max Pulse is a non-invasive assessment of arterial elasticity and autonomic nervous system balance. It evaluates vascular tone and endothelial responsiveness, offering insight into early functional cardiovascular stress.
Unlike structural imaging, it reflects how well your arteries adapt in real time to physiologic demand. When combined with CIMT and advanced labs, it helps identify modifiable drivers of vascular aging and guides targeted risk-reduction strategies. read more

Gastrointestinal/Microbiome Testing

GI-MAP - testing provides a detailed analysis of the gut microbiome, including bacterial balance, parasites, viruses, fungi, and markers of inflammation and immune activation. It helps identify hidden drivers of bloating, autoimmune activation, metabolic dysfunction, and chronic inflammation. By assessing microbial patterns alongside digestive and barrier markers, we gain insight into gut integrity and immune regulation. This allows for targeted, evidence-informed interventions rather than generalized probiotic or elimination approaches. The GI-MAP is a comprehensive stool test that uses quantitative polymerase chain reaction (qPCR) to support better decision-making.
